Residential: £5,000
The Residential offers an immersive learning experience where students join us for training at a villa in
Mallorca. The course fee includes the full qualification, accommodation throughout the stay as well as three
healthy and delicious chef-cooked meals each training day.
Residential: Live out £4,000
This option is ideal for anyone who lives locally to where the Residential is taking place. This means you will be
staying at your own accommodation, and commuting to the villa where training will take place daily. You will
also be provided with a healthy chef-prepared lunch each day.
Online: Flexible £3,500
If you’re not able to join us in person, our 2-week intensive Purser Program allows you to study from wherever
you are in the world, with live lectures, learning and assignments delivered through our state-of-the-art 5th
generation Virtual Learning Environment (kelp.).
